FIFA Best Awards 2024: Nominees Announced
FIFA has revealed the nominees for the 2024 Best Awards, set to take place in London on Monday night. The event, now in its third occurrence in the vibrant city, promises to be a celebration of football excellence, as the best men’s and women’s players, coaches, and goalkeepers from the last season will be recognized.
The nominations, announced in September 2023, were determined through a meticulous process involving an international jury consisting of national team coaches, captains, specialist journalists, and passionate fans who cast over a million votes worldwide on FIFA’s official website.
The Best Awards, often likened to the prestigious Ballon d’Or, saw Lionel Messi clinch the Best Men’s Player accolade last year after leading Argentina to victory in the World Cup held in Qatar. This year, Messi finds himself among the finalists once again, competing against prolific Manchester City striker Erling Haaland and the dynamic PSG and France forward Kylian Mbappe.
For the Best Women’s Player category, Spain’s Women’s World Cup winner Aitana Bonmati emerges as the favorite. The Barcelona midfielder faces competition from her teammate Jenni Hermoso and Real Madrid’s Linda Caicedo.
The awards ceremony, scheduled for Monday, January 15, 2024, at 7:30 pm GMT in London, will be accessible for free streaming on the FIFA website and through FIFA+. Fans worldwide can eagerly anticipate the live coverage of this prestigious event, highlighting the global interest in the sport.
Apart from the player awards, the ceremony will also recognize outstanding coaches and goalkeepers in both the men’s and women’s categories. The finalists for these categories include renowned figures such as Pep Guardiola, Simone Inzaghi, Luciano Spalletti, Jonatan Giraldez, Emma Hayes, Sarina Wiegman, Yassine Bounou, Thibaut Courtois, Ederson, Mackenzie Arnold, Cata Coll, and Mary Earps.
Additionally, the much-coveted Puskas Award for the best goal of the year will be contested between Julio Enciso’s strike for Brighton against Manchester City and Guilherme Madruga’s exceptional goal for Botafogo-SP against Novorizontino.
